DMSET(8)  —  NEWS-OS Programmer’s Manual

NAME

dmset − NEWS−OS display manager setup command

SYNOPSIS

/usr/sony/etc/dmset [ −x | −n ]

DESCRIPTION

dmset command cause to use display manager sxdm.  dmset command set the DM= entry in /etc/rc.custom to sxdm, and ty_status entry of console in /etc/ttys to off. 
After setup the /etc/rc.custom and /etc/ttys, dmset ask if reboot the system. If you key in y, immediately execute the reboot process. Otherwise, you have to reboot the system manually. 

Options to dmset are:

−x option use xdm for sxdm. 

−n If you don’t want to use both sxdm and xdm, you can use this option.  It sets the ty_status entry of console in /etc/ttys to on.  Then you can login on console by getty(8). 

Only the super user is permitted to execute dmset command.  You have to setup using −n option if you don’t use bitmap display as console. 

FILES

/etc/rc.custom
/etc/ttys
